Message type: E = Error
Message class: HRPAYDEZFA - Data exchange with ZfA
Message number: 113
Message text: Return Code or message ID not available

- Return Code or message ID not available ?The SAP error message HRPAYDEZFA113, which indicates that a return code or message ID is not available, typically arises in the context of payroll processing or related HR functions. Here’s a breakdown of the potential causes, solutions, and related information for this error:
Causes:
- Missing Configuration: The error may occur if there is a missing or incorrect configuration in the payroll schema or in the related infotypes.
- Custom Code Issues: If there are custom enhancements or modifications in the payroll process, they might not be handling return codes properly.
- Data Issues: Inconsistent or incomplete data in the employee master records or payroll results can lead to this error.
- System Updates: If there have been recent updates or changes to the SAP system, it might affect the existing configurations or custom code.
- Authorization Issues: Sometimes, the user executing the payroll process may not have the necessary authorizations, leading to this error.
Solutions:
- Check Configuration: Review the payroll schema and ensure that all necessary configurations are in place. Pay special attention to the processing of return codes.
- Review Custom Code: If there are any custom enhancements, review the code to ensure it correctly handles return codes and messages.
- Data Validation: Validate the employee data in the relevant infotypes to ensure that all required fields are filled out correctly.
- System Logs: Check the system logs (transaction SLG1) for any additional error messages or warnings that might provide more context about the issue.
- Authorization Check: Ensure that the user has the necessary authorizations to execute the payroll process.
- SAP Notes: Search for relevant SAP Notes in the SAP Support Portal that might address this specific error or provide patches or updates.
- Testing: If possible, replicate the issue in a test environment to better understand the conditions under which the error occurs.
